Leading Scrub Brands Guide
The world of performance scrubs is led by several prominent companies, each presenting unique qualities designed to address the needs of medical practitioners. Brands like FIGS and Cherokee are famous for their refined aesthetics and useful elements, meeting both comfort and style. Dickies and Landau highlight reliability and practicality, guaranteeing endurance in demanding environments. At the same time, Grey's Anatomy by Barco integrates elegance with capability, drawing to those looking for quality fabrics. Medelita centers on a sophisticated look while preserving comfort, frequently preferred by those in surgical settings. Every brand underscores particular qualities, ranging from breathable fabrics to fitted silhouettes, providing medical staff the ability to select options that suit their unique requirements and choices.
Innovative Fabric Technologies
In what ways do advanced fabric technologies enhance scrubs' durability? These advancements greatly boost comfort, longevity, and practicality. Brands are continually using moisture-wicking fabrics to keep healthcare professionals comfortable during lengthy shifts. Antimicrobial fabrics assist in eliminating odors and preserving hygiene, something that is critical in medical settings. Furthermore, elastic textiles provide greater freedom of movement, enabling the dynamic movements essential in healthcare environments. Certain brands integrate temperature-regulating fibers that adapt to body heat, promoting enhanced comfort throughout the day. Additionally, lightweight materials ensure that scrubs stay breathable, avoiding overheating. Ultimately, innovative fabric technologies not only enhance the overall performance of scrubs but also promote the well-being of professionals in challenging work environments.

Think about Material Flexibility
How can the choice of fabric affect the overall shape and comfort of scrubs? The pliability of fabric plays a vital role in determining how well scrubs conform to the body while allowing for freedom of movement. Fabrics with spandex or elastane offer a stretchy quality that enhances mobility, making them perfect for healthcare professionals who are often on their feet. Conversely, more rigid materials may restrict movement, leading to discomfort during long shifts. Additionally, breathable fabrics like cotton blends can help control body temperature, further contributing to overall comfort. Ultimately, selecting scrubs with the right fabric flexibility ensures that professionals can perform their duties effectively without compromising on comfort or style. This careful consideration is essential for achieving peak functionality in the workplace.

How Can I Appropriately Maintain My Performance Scrubs?
To adequately look after performance scrubs, wash them in cold water with mild detergent, avoid bleach, and use low heat drying. Place them in a cool, dry environment to maintain fabric integrity and longevity.
